πŸ” Regional Insight: Barima-Waini

Barima-Waini is the northwesternmost region of Guyana, bordering Venezuela. Known for its rich Amerindian heritage, the Orinoco delta wetlands, and significant mining operations. Population center is Mabaruma.

Towns & Villages in this Region

Indigenous Villages: Santa Rosa, Waramuri, Manawarin, Kwebanna, Baramita, Chinese Landing.
